Justice Department Backs Paramount in Merger Bond Dispute

The Department of Justice has sided with Paramount in a legal battle with 12 states over the Warner Bros. merger. Paramount argues it could lose $1.88 billion due to delays from the states' antitrust lawsuit. The company is asking the court to require the states to post a bond.

Expanded Detail

Paramount's request centers on the financial toll it claims the states' antitrust challenge has inflicted. The company has calculated its losses at $1.88 billion, a figure it attributes directly to the stalled Warner Bros. merger. Judge Araceli Martinez-Olguin now must weigh whether the 12-state coalition should post that amount as security before the litigation proceeds further.

The Justice Department's intervention signals federal alignment with Paramount's position, suggesting the states' lawsuit may lack sufficient merit to justify the merger's continued delay. The bond, if required, would serve as compensation should Paramount ultimately prevail at trial. The states have not yet publicly responded to the bond motion, leaving the judge's ruling as the next pivotal step in this dispute.
